MPAA’s Chris Dodd says ratings should be “far more transparent,” defends overall system

Former senator Chris Dodd, chairman of the MPAA, said at CinemaCon that the current American ratings system should be “far more transparent,” surprising movie fans with the news that he actually has some clue as to why the organization is so reviled.
